Retinal Degeneration in a Rodent Model of Smith-Lemli-Opitz Syndrome: Electrophysiologic, Biochemical, and Morphologic Features
OBJECTIVE: To assess the electrophysiologic, histologic, and biochemical features of an animal model of Smith-Lemli-Opitz syndrome (SLOS).
